The Challenge with Traditional Timber Posts

Timber has been the standard fencing material for decades, but it comes with several long-term disadvantages.

Common problems include:

  • Rot caused by moisture
  • Damage from termites
  • Splitting during dry seasons
  • Frequent repainting
  • Short service life

Replacing damaged timber posts every few years significantly increases maintenance costs.

Why are recycled plastic fence posts better than timber posts?

Recycled plastic fence posts last significantly longer than timber because they do not rot, split, absorb water, or suffer termite damage. They require virtually no maintenance and can last for over 30 years, making them a cost-effective investment.

Are recycled plastic fence posts suitable for Kenya’s climate?

Yes. Recycled plastic fence posts are designed to withstand Kenya’s diverse weather conditions, including intense sunshine, heavy rainfall, high humidity, and cold temperatures. They do not warp, crack, or deteriorate due to weather exposure.

What are recycled plastic fence posts made from?

They are manufactured from 100% recycled plastic waste collected from post-consumer and industrial sources. Recycling this plastic helps reduce environmental pollution while producing durable fencing products.
